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- use std::sync::{Arc, Mutex};
- #[derive(Clone)]
- struct Struct {}
- static mut STRUCT: Arc<Mutex<Option<Struct>>> = Arc::new(Mutex::new(None));
- fn main()
- {
- let s = STRUCT.lock().unwrap();
- s = Some(Struct{});
- }
Add Comment
Please, Sign In to add comment